So in this problem, we want to plot on a single graph, distance versus time, for the first two trips from houston to des moines described on page 17.
00:08
And for each trip, we want to identify graphically the average velocity, and for each segment of the trip, the instantaneous velocity.
00:15
So both trips will start at the same place.
00:17
Houston will be at point a.
00:19
So x of a equals negative 1 ,000 kilometers at time t .a.
00:23
Equals 0.
00:24
And they both end at the same place, des moines, or point b.
00:27
So xb will be 300 kilometers at tb is 2 .6 hours.
00:33
So they have the same overall displacement and in the same time period.
00:55
And therefore the same average velocity, which is 500 kilometers an hour.
01:07
So this is the slope of a straight line ab, and it's also the graph of the first strip, a direct flight at a constant velocity...
